Average Pharmacy Technicians Salary in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N

Pharmacy Technicians in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N earn an average annual salary of $41,720. This figure is slightly below the national average of $44,160, suggesting localized economic factors and demand dynamics influence compensation in this specific Indiana region. The pay scale reflects the unique balance of local market conditions and the cost of living within the Lafayette-West Lafayette area.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 340 employees in the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N area with a job density of 3.344 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
